What Is Blossom End Rot?

Blossom end rot is a common disorder in bell peppers, tomatoes, and other fruits. It appears as a brown or black spot on the bottom (blossom end) of the fruit. The spot is soft at first, but later becomes sunken and leathery. Many gardeners mistake it for a disease, but it’s actually a physiological disorder—not caused by bacteria or fungi.

The affected area can cover a small portion or most of the fruit. Sometimes the spot becomes dry and shrinks. In severe cases, the pepper can rot completely. It’s not dangerous to humans, but affected peppers are less appealing and may taste bitter.

Why Does Blossom End Rot Happen?

Blossom end rot is mainly caused by calcium deficiency in the developing fruit. Calcium is an important mineral for cell walls. If the fruit does not get enough calcium, cells break down and rot starts. But lack of calcium is rarely because the soil has no calcium; usually, other factors prevent the plant from absorbing it.

Here are the main causes:

  • Irregular Watering: If soil dries out, the plant cannot absorb calcium. Too much or too little water stresses the plant and blocks nutrient movement.
  • Rapid Growth Spurts: Sudden changes in temperature or too much fertilizer can cause the plant to grow fast, outpacing calcium supply.
  • High Nitrogen Levels: Excess nitrogen encourages leaf growth but can reduce calcium transport to fruits.
  • Root Damage: If roots are disturbed by transplanting or cultivation, they may not take up enough nutrients.
  • Salty Soil: High salts from fertilizers or poor water can block calcium uptake.

Even if your soil has plenty of calcium, your bell peppers may still get blossom end rot if these conditions are present.

Symptoms And How To Identify Blossom End Rot

Spotting blossom end rot early can help you act before losing your whole crop. Look for these signs:

  • Small, water-soaked spots at the blossom end of young peppers
  • Spots become brown or black, sunken, and dry
  • The affected area feels leathery or shriveled
  • Fruit may be misshapen or smaller than normal

Sometimes, blossom end rot is confused with other problems like sunscald or anthracnose. But sunscald appears on the side facing the sun, not the bottom. Anthracnose is caused by fungus and spreads differently.

The Science Behind Calcium Uptake

Understanding how bell pepper plants absorb calcium helps prevent problems. Calcium moves from the roots to the fruits with water. If the plant is stressed or water is inconsistent, calcium may not reach the peppers.

Unlike other nutrients, calcium does not move freely inside the plant. Once it enters a leaf or fruit, it stays there. That’s why early problems can’t be fixed by adding calcium later—it needs to be available when the fruit is forming.

Some soils have plenty of calcium, but it’s locked up and not available. Too much nitrogen or potassium can compete for uptake, making it harder for plants to get calcium.

How To Prevent Blossom End Rot

Prevention is much easier than cure. Here are proven ways to avoid blossom end rot in your bell peppers:

1. Maintain Consistent Soil Moisture

Water regularly and evenly. Do not let the soil dry out completely, then flood it. Use mulch to retain moisture and prevent evaporation. Aim for about 1–1.5 inches of water per week.

2. Use Balanced Fertilizers

Avoid high-nitrogen fertilizers. Look for balanced formulas or organic compost. Too much nitrogen can make plants grow fast but increase blossom end rot.

3. Test Your Soil

Check soil pH and calcium levels. Ideal pH for bell peppers is 6.2–6.8. If pH is too low (acidic), calcium is not available. Lime can raise pH and add calcium.

4. Avoid Root Disturbance

Be gentle when transplanting. Do not dig near roots once the plant is established. Damaged roots take up fewer nutrients.

5. Mulch And Protect

Apply a layer of mulch around each plant. This keeps soil temperature steady and prevents water loss.

6. Use Calcium Supplements Wisely

If your soil is low in calcium, add gypsum or lime before planting. Foliar sprays can help, but only if the plant is actively growing. However, sprays are less effective than soil amendments.

7. Control Salt Buildup

Flush soil with water if you use fertilizers often. Too much salt blocks calcium uptake.

8. Monitor Plant Health

Keep an eye on weather, soil, and plant growth. Act quickly if you see symptoms.

Treating Blossom End Rot: What To Do If You See Symptoms

Once blossom end rot appears, it cannot be reversed in affected fruits. However, you can take action to prevent it spreading to new peppers.

  • Remove affected fruits. This helps the plant focus on healthy peppers.
  • Check watering and soil moisture. Adjust your schedule if needed.
  • Add calcium to soil if tests show deficiency.
  • Reduce fertilizer use, especially nitrogen.
  • Use mulch to maintain moisture.

Do not use pepper fruits with severe rot, but mildly affected peppers can be trimmed and used if you cut away the bad part.

Common Mistakes In Dealing With Blossom End Rot

Many gardeners make mistakes that worsen blossom end rot. Avoid these pitfalls:

  • Overwatering after seeing symptoms: Sudden flooding stresses roots more.
  • Applying calcium sprays too late: Sprays only help if the fruit is still growing.
  • Ignoring soil pH: Low pH locks up calcium even if there’s plenty in the soil.
  • Using too much fertilizer: Excess nutrients can block calcium uptake.
  • Planting peppers in the same spot every year without soil improvement: Diseases and nutrient imbalance build up.

Real-life Examples And Case Studies

Let’s look at some practical examples:

Case 1: Container-grown Peppers

A gardener in California noticed blossom end rot in nearly every pepper grown in containers. After testing, the soil was found to dry out quickly. By switching to a larger container and using mulch, the problem disappeared.

Case 2: Greenhouse Peppers

In a commercial greenhouse, bell peppers developed blossom end rot after a heatwave. The grower increased watering and reduced nitrogen fertilizer. Within weeks, new fruits were healthy.

Case 3: Backyard Garden

A home gardener had good soil but kept adding fertilizer. After a soil test, they discovered high salt levels. Flushing the soil and using less fertilizer solved the problem.

These examples show that blossom end rot can happen in many different settings, but simple changes often fix it.

Advanced Insights: What Beginners Usually Miss

Many people think blossom end rot is just a calcium problem, but there are deeper factors:

  • Timing matters: Calcium must be available when the pepper is forming—not later.
  • Leaf growth competes with fruit: If plants grow too many leaves (from excess nitrogen), fruits get less calcium.
  • Container size affects health: Small containers dry faster and restrict roots, making blossom end rot more likely.

These points are often missed by beginners. Smart watering and balanced nutrients are more effective than simply adding calcium.

Blossom End Rot In Different Climates

Local climate affects how often you see blossom end rot. In hot, dry regions, soil dries quickly and peppers suffer more. In rainy climates, water may wash away nutrients and cause pH changes.

Tropical climates: Rapid growth during rainy season can lead to blossom end rot.

Cool climates: Slow growth means less risk, but sudden heat waves increase risk.

Adapt your watering and mulching based on your weather. In containers, check soil daily.

Frequently Asked Questions

What Causes Blossom End Rot In Bell Peppers?

Blossom end rot is mainly caused by calcium deficiency in the fruit, often due to irregular watering, rapid growth, or high nitrogen fertilizer.

Can I Eat Bell Peppers With Blossom End Rot?

Yes, you can eat peppers if you cut away the affected part. The rot is not harmful to humans, but the damaged area may taste bitter.

How Can I Fix Blossom End Rot Once It Starts?

You cannot fix affected fruits, but you can prevent it in new peppers by improving watering, adjusting fertilizer, and adding calcium to the soil.

Will Blossom End Rot Spread From Fruit To Fruit?

No, blossom end rot is not contagious. It affects individual fruits based on plant health and conditions.

Do Calcium Sprays Work For Blossom End Rot?

Calcium sprays help only if applied when fruit is forming. They are less effective than soil amendments and proper watering.
